  • There are about 245,000 Muslims living in Birmingham and about 120 Mosques. It is a diverse community and the people we work with might have Muslim friends, learn about Islam in school, or have Muslim relatives. Islam is the second largest religion in Birmingham and across the UK. The age profile of Muslims is younger than almost all other faiths, and Muslims make up a significant proportion of the children and young people across Birmingham.
